Inventory Executive - (SAP Experienced)
Department: Store Operations / Inventory Management
Reporting To: Store Manager / Operations Manager
Job Summary
The Inventory Executive is responsible for ensuring accurate inventory management, stock reconciliation, and seamless inventory operations using SAP. The role requires maintaining inventory accuracy, processing stock transactions in SAP, coordinating with warehouse and sales teams, and ensuring compliance with company SOPs to minimize stock variance and maximize product availability.
Key Responsibilities
Process Goods Receipt Notes (GRN), stock transfers, stock adjustments, and Goods Issue (GI) transactions in SAP.
Verify inward stock against purchase orders, invoices, and delivery challans.
Maintain accurate inventory records in SAP and ensure real-time stock updates.
Perform daily stock reconciliation between physical inventory and SAP records.
Conduct cycle counts, perpetual inventory checks, and annual stock audits.
Investigate inventory discrepancies and initiate corrective actions.
Coordinate inter-store and warehouse stock transfers through SAP.
Monitor ageing inventory, slow-moving stock, and non-moving inventory.
Manage damaged, defective, RTV (Return to Vendor), and demo stock as per company SOPs.
Prepare daily, weekly, and monthly inventory reports using SAP and Microsoft Excel.
Ensure timely replenishment of fast-moving products by coordinating with procurement and warehouse teams.
Support internal and external inventory audits by providing accurate documentation.
Ensure compliance with inventory control procedures, loss prevention policies, and audit standards.
Collaborate with the Sales, Finance, Warehouse, and Logistics teams for smooth inventory operations.
Maintain proper documentation for stock movement and inventory transactions.
